Summer Music in City Churches

About

Ten days of concerts of beautiful music, programmed around themes of love, romance and Shakespeare are promised as the Summer Music in City Churches Festival returns for its sixth year. Hosted this summer in the historic church of St Giles-without-Cripplegate within London's Square Mile, highlights of the programme entitled 'Love's Labours' include performances by the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ra, City of London Choir, and soloists Rachel Nicholls, Roderick Williams, Iain Farrington, Nigel Hess, Fenella Humphreys and David Juritz. Chamber concerts continue throughout the day and the Festival ends with a rousing choral celebration for all the family.
